Lines Matching defs:taps

238 static const uint16_t *dpp1_dscl_get_filter_coeffs_64p(int taps, struct fixed31_32 ratio)
240 if (taps == 8)
242 else if (taps == 7)
244 else if (taps == 6)
246 else if (taps == 5)
248 else if (taps == 4)
250 else if (taps == 3)
252 else if (taps == 2)
254 else if (taps == 1)
265 uint32_t taps,
269 const int tap_pairs = (taps + 1) / 2;
281 even_coef = filter[phase * taps + 2 * pair];
282 if ((pair * 2 + 1) < taps)
283 odd_coef = filter[phase * taps + 2 * pair + 1];
318 h_2tap_hardcode_coef_en = scl_data->taps.h_taps < 3
319 && scl_data->taps.h_taps_c < 3
320 && (scl_data->taps.h_taps > 1 && scl_data->taps.h_taps_c > 1);
321 v_2tap_hardcode_coef_en = scl_data->taps.v_taps < 3
322 && scl_data->taps.v_taps_c < 3
323 && (scl_data->taps.v_taps > 1 && scl_data->taps.v_taps_c > 1);
340 scl_data->taps.h_taps, scl_data->ratios.horz);
342 scl_data->taps.v_taps, scl_data->ratios.vert);
349 scl_data->taps.h_taps_c, scl_data->ratios.horz_c);
351 scl_data->taps.v_taps_c, scl_data->ratios.vert_c);
361 dpp, scl_data->taps.h_taps,
367 dpp, scl_data->taps.v_taps,
374 dpp, scl_data->taps.h_taps_c,
379 dpp, scl_data->taps.v_taps_c,
486 int vtaps = scl_data->taps.v_taps;
487 int vtaps_c = scl_data->taps.v_taps_c;
573 SCL_V_NUM_TAPS, scl_data->taps.v_taps - 1,
574 SCL_H_NUM_TAPS, scl_data->taps.h_taps - 1,
575 SCL_V_NUM_TAPS_C, scl_data->taps.v_taps_c - 1,
576 SCL_H_NUM_TAPS_C, scl_data->taps.h_taps_c - 1);
733 SCL_V_NUM_TAPS, scl_data->taps.v_taps - 1,
734 SCL_H_NUM_TAPS, scl_data->taps.h_taps - 1,
735 SCL_V_NUM_TAPS_C, scl_data->taps.v_taps_c - 1,
736 SCL_H_NUM_TAPS_C, scl_data->taps.h_taps_c - 1);